RESPONDENT/RESPONDENT Petition filed praying that in the circumstances stated therein and in the petition filed therewith the High Court may be pleased to Extend the time permitted by this Honourable Court to deposit the amount of Rs.100000/- and produce the sureties vide order in Crl.o.P.(MD).No.8712/2022 dated 19.05.2022.

Order : This petition coming up for orders on this day, upon perusing the petition filed in support thereof and upon hearing the arguments of MR.N.VIGNESH, Advocate for the petitioner and of MR.M.VAIKKAM KARUNANITHI, Government Advocate (Crimal Side)on behalf of the Respondent, the court made the following order:- This petition has been filed to extend the time permitted by this Court to deposit the amount of Rs.1,00,000/- and produce the sureties vide order in Crl.OP(MD)No.8712 of 2022 dated 19.05.2022.

2. The learned counsel for the petitioner seeks time to produce sureties. Due to financial crisis, the petitioner is unable to execute sureties with in the stipulated time as per the order of Crl.OP(MD)No.8712 of 2022 dated 19.05.2022.

https://hcservices.ecourts.gov.in/hcservices/ 1/2

CRL MP(MD) No.6649 of 2022

3. In view of the same, time granted by this Court vide order dated 19.05.2022 in Crl.OP(MD)No.8712 of 2022 is extended further for a period of fifteen days from the date of receipt of copy of this order.
